STEPS
1
BE CAREFUL WHERE YOU GRIP YOUR IPHONE. If you are covering up the reception points, you'll either block out receipt of signals or you'll lower their strength. Apple says this is true for all phones, even other brands. 2
DON\'T COVER THE LOWER RIGHT HAND SIDE OF THE IPHONE 3GS WITH YOUR HAND WHEN USING THE IPHONE. 3
DON\'T COVER THE BLACK STRIP FOUND IN THE LOWER LEFT HAND CORNER OF THE IPHONE 4\'S METAL BAND WHEN USING THE PHONE. 4
BUY A BUMPER CASE. These can help improve the reception because they oblige your hand to avoid the problem areas. 5
CHECK FOR OTHER POSSIBLE PROBLEMS. Read the manual or call your Apple rep. METHOD 1 OF 1: MAKE YOUR OWN BUMPER
1
GET A RUBBER WRISTBAND THAT MANY ORGANIZATIONS GIVE AWAY FOR FREE. 2
STRETCH THE WRISTBAND AROUND THE METAL FRAME OF THE IPHONE. 3
WITH AN EXACTO-KNIFE, CUT OUT HOLES FOR THE DOCK, HEADPHONE JACK, MUTE SWITCH, ETC. You may want to mark these spots with a pen and then take the wristband off the phone before cutting it so that you do not accidentally damage the phone. TIPS
